Look It Up Word List READ the words and their meanings.

ad•jec•tive—AJ-ihk-tihv noun a word that describes something, like pretty or blue

def•i•ni•tion—dehf-uh-NIHSH-uhn noun the meaning of a word de•scribe—dih-SKRIB verb to make a picture with words, like “a pretty girl in a blue dress” dic•tion•ar•y—DIHK-shuh-nehr-ee noun a book filled with definitions of words mean•ing—MEE-nihng noun the idea of a word, what it means noun—nown noun a word that stands for a person, place, or thing verb—verb noun a word that stands for an action, like run

A dictionary also tells you how many syllables a word has. A syllable is each part of a word that takes one beat to say. So mean has one syllable and meaning has two syllables. A dot shows the break for each syllable: mean•ing. READ each word out loud. Then WRITE the number of syllables.
